How can organizations incentivize employees to actively participate in technology training programs and embrace a culture of continuous learning and innovation?
Organizations can incentivize employees to actively participate in technology training programs by offering rewards such as promotions, bonuses, or recognition for completing courses. Providing opportunities for career advancement or skill development through training programs can also motivate employees to participate. Creating a supportive and inclusive learning environment, where employees feel encouraged to explore new technologies and ideas, can help foster a culture of continuous learning and innovation within the organization. Additionally, offering flexible training options, such as online courses or lunch-and-learn sessions, can make it easier for employees to engage in training programs.
